4 . ,     ,  ,        logLorg/slf4j/Logger; payService%Lcom/zbkj/service/service/PayService;RuntimeVisibleAnnotations8Lorg/springframework/beans/factory/annotation/Autowired;redisson!Lorg/redisson/api/RedissonClient;()VCodeLineNumberTableLocalVariableTablethis)Lcom/zbkj/front/controller/PayController; getPayConfig'()Lcom/zbkj/common/result/CommonResult; SignatureU()Lcom/zbkj/common/result/CommonResult;%Lio/swagger/annotations/ApiOperation;value获取支付配置8Lorg/springframework/web/bind/annotation/RequestMapping; /get/configmethod7Lorg/springframework/web/bind/annotation/RequestMethod;GETpaymentP(Lcom/zbkj/common/request/OrderPayRequest;)Lcom/zbkj/common/result/CommonResult;eLjava/lang/Exception;orderPayRequest)Lcom/zbkj/common/request/OrderPayRequest;lockIdLjava/lang/String;lockLorg/redisson/api/RLock; StackMapTableMethodParameters(Lcom/zbkj/common/request/OrderPayRequest;)Lcom/zbkj/common/result/CommonResult; 订单支付/paymentPOST"RuntimeVisibleParameterAnnotations5Lorg/springframework/web/bind/annotation/RequestBody;5Lorg/springframework/validation/annotation/Validated;queryPayResult9(Ljava/lang/String;)Lcom/zbkj/common/result/CommonResult;orderNoN(Ljava/lang/String;)Lcom/zbkj/common/result/CommonResult;查询订单微信支付结果"/query/wechat/pay/result/{orderNo}6Lorg/springframework/web/bind/annotation/PathVariable;queryAliPayResult!查询订单支付宝支付结果/query/ali/pay/result/{orderNo}sendCodeP(Lcom/zbkj/common/request/SendCodeRequest;)Lcom/zbkj/common/result/CommonResult;request)Lcom/zbkj/common/request/SendCodeRequest;d(Lcom/zbkj/common/request/SendCodeRequest;)Lcom/zbkj/common/result/CommonResult;发送短信钱包验证码 /send/codecheckOrderPaySuccess查询订单支付结果/query/pay/result/{orderNo} SourceFilePayController.java8Lorg/springframework/web/bind/annotation/RestController; api/front/payLio/swagger/annotations/Api;tags 支付管理 78 12 > java/lang/StringBuilder TRANSPAYMENT  56   /0 :getLock:   J  :unLock: 8$订单支付中,请勿重复操作 ejava/lang/Exception payment error k   发送成功 发送失败 'com/zbkj/front/controller/PayController java/lang/Objectjava/lang/Stringorg/redisson/api/RLock#com/zbkj/common/result/CommonResult'com/zbkj/common/request/OrderPayRequestjava/lang/Throwable#com/zbkj/service/service/PayService.()Lcom/zbkj/common/response/PayConfigResponse;success9(Ljava/lang/Object;)Lcom/zbkj/common/result/CommonResult;append-(Ljava/lang/String;)Ljava/lang/StringBuilder; getOrderNo()Ljava/lang/String;toStringorg/redisson/api/RedissonClientgetLock,(Ljava/lang/String;)Lorg/redisson/api/RLock;java/util/concurrent/TimeUnitSECONDSLjava/util/concurrent/TimeUnit;tryLock$(JJLjava/util/concurrent/TimeUnit;)Zjava/lang/Thread currentThread()Ljava/lang/Thread;getId()J(J)Ljava/lang/StringBuilder;org/slf4j/Loggerdebug(Ljava/lang/String;)V\(Lcom/zbkj/common/request/OrderPayRequest;)Lcom/zbkj/common/response/OrderPayResultResponse;isHeldByCurrentThread()Zunlockfailederror*(Ljava/lang/String;Ljava/lang/Throwable;)V getMessagequeryWechatPayResult'(Ljava/lang/String;)Ljava/lang/Boolean;'com/zbkj/common/request/SendCodeRequestgetPhonesendWalletCodejava/lang/Boolean booleanValuecheckPayResult(Ljava/lang/String;)ZvalueOf(Z)Ljava/lang/Boolean;org/slf4j/LoggerFactory getLogger%(Ljava/lang/Class;)Lorg/slf4j/Logger;!,./012345634789/*:$; <=>?97 *:.;  <=@A3!BCsDEC[sFG[eHIJK9`Y+  M* , N- lY, *+:--Y, -:--Y, -: !":--Y, -:--Y, -"g"g((((*(:f45"748X9gApBC9;ABC;=>?ABC%?(A3BWC]E;4LLM`<=`NOIPQ">RSTTUVW9WXYUVZJZWXYUV[4[\N@]3!BCs^EC[s_G[eH`a bcde9B*+#:K;<=fQ\f@g3!BCshEC[siG[eHIa jCsfke9B*+$:Q;<=fQ\f@g3!BCslEC[smG[eHIa jCsfno9d*+%&' ():WXZ;<=pqT\p@r3!BCssEC[stG[eH`a bcue9E*+*+:`;<=fQ\f@g3!BCsvEC[swG[eHIa jCsfx89! ,-: yz3{EC[s|}~[s